Top 5 Strategies to Automate Your Payment Due Date Reminders
Managing payments on time is crucial for maintaining healthy cash flow and strong relationships with clients and vendors. Automating payment due date reminders can help businesses reduce late payments and save time. In this article, we’ll explore the top five strategies to effectively automate your payment due date reminders, ensuring you stay on top of your financial obligations effortlessly.
Use Automated Email Reminder Systems
Automated email reminders are one of the simplest and most effective ways to notify customers about upcoming payment due dates. Many invoicing and accounting software solutions offer customizable email templates that you can schedule to be sent at specific intervals before the payment is due. This approach minimizes manual follow-ups and keeps the communication professional and consistent.
Implement SMS Notification Services
Text message reminders provide a direct and immediate way to reach customers. By integrating SMS notification services into your payment system, you can send short, timely reminders that have high open and response rates. This is especially useful for customers who may overlook emails or prefer mobile communications.
Leverage Mobile App Notifications
If your business has a mobile app or uses third-party payment apps, push notifications can serve as effective reminders. These alerts pop up on users’ devices, making them hard to miss. Automating these notifications based on payment schedules helps customers remember their due dates without extra effort from your team.
Schedule Automated Phone Calls
For businesses dealing with high-value payments or clients who prefer personal contact, automated phone call reminders can be beneficial. Using voice automation technology, you can schedule calls that deliver clear messages about payment due dates, ensuring the reminder is both heard and acknowledged.
Integrate Payment Reminders with Calendar Apps
Allowing customers to add payment due dates directly into their digital calendars through automated links or invites helps them stay organized. Integration with popular calendar apps like Google Calendar or Outlook ensures they receive multiple reminders leading up to the payment date, reducing the risk of late payments.
Automating your payment due date reminders not only enhances efficiency but also improves customer experience by providing timely and consistent communication. By implementing these five strategies—email systems, SMS notifications, mobile app alerts, automated calls, and calendar integrations—you can streamline your accounts receivable process and maintain stronger financial health.
